TEED-5126 : Methods for Building Inclusive Elementary Classrooms
Teacher Education (MIT) | College of Education | GR
About this Course
This course addresses the theoretical and pedagogical tools, instructional approaches, strategies, and materials for addressing the academic and behavior needs of students with disabilities in inclusive K-8 classrooms. Emphasis is on how to assess and intervene when students have both academic and behavioral difficulties. Course concepts and pedagogical skills will be applied in field settings.
